I have found no court record that would create a foster situation. The court records with respect to Madison show the State of Oregon initiating a child support action on behalf of the Madison's mother back in 2017 - this means Madison's mother was receiving some sort of state assistance. That support was terminated in April of 2018. This would be when Sean was given custody as there are no other parties to the case. The latest activity is that Madison's mother went to court for parenting time/custody in March of this year and the case is on-going. It is still in mediation. Sean was a no show for a mediation session on August 1st per the docket. There is zero indication that there would be any kind of change in custody based on the docket but rather some sort of change with regards to visitation.

I don't know what the situation is with regards to Madison's mother and whether whatever changes related to visitation she was seeking is why Sean and Madison are missing. Don't want to sleuth too far in that direction.

From the story you linked we now know who had last seen them.

29-year-old Sean Michael Moss and his daughter, Madison Moss were reported missing on Monday, August 12 at 10:18 a.m.
They were last seen by Moss' co-worker on the evening of Friday, August 9.
Family members were expecting Sean and Madison to attend the Douglas County Fair on August 10, but they did not arrive.​
 
They have both been added to NAMUS.
